温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

hbase nosql有哪些数据质量提升方法呢

发布时间:2024-12-26 19:14:42 来源:亿速云 阅读:78 作者:小樊 栏目:关系型数据库

HBase分布式NoSQL数据库,提供了多种方法来提升数据质量,包括数据清洗、数据模型优化、配置优化等。以下是一些关键的方法:

HBase数据质量提升方法

  • 数据清洗:定期清理过期数据,删除重复项,修复错误的数据类型,处理缺失值等,以提高数据分析和业务决策的准确性。
  • 数据模型优化:合理设计表的列簇、列族和列的结构,避免过多的列族和冗余的数据。选择合适的行键,使得数据在分布式存储中能够均匀分布,避免热点数据和数据倾斜。
  • 配置优化:调整HBase的配置参数,如Block Cache大小,合理配置MemStore大小,启用批量写入等,以减少网络传输和写入开销,提高读写性能。

HBase性能优化和数据质量提升的最佳实践

  • 定期监控性能指标:使用HBase自带的监控工具(如HBase Web UI、JMX等)来监控集群性能和资源使用情况,根据监控结果调整配置参数。
  • 采用ETL工具自动化数据清洗过程:对频繁读取的热点数据进行专门的缓存优化,提高数据处理的效率和准确性。
  • 建立数据审计跟踪:记录数据清洗过程中的所有操作,确保每一步操作都有据可查,以便于问题追踪和后续优化。

通过上述方法,可以有效地提升HBase中的数据质量和系统性能,确保数据的高可用性和准确性。需要注意的是,不同的应用场景和数据特征可能需要不同的调优策略,因此在进行调优时需要根据实际情况进行综合考虑和调整。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I